The invention relates a fluid or air propeller propulsion apparatus using modified state of the art propeller that reduces the typical propeller slipstream disc contraction at the propeller tips, by simply adding a novel channel or trough on the back surface spanwise midway between the leading edge and trailing edge. A portion of the air or fluid flowing over the back face of propeller blade is raked off and collected in the channel during rotation of the propeller, wherein the fluid or air is acted upon by centrifugal force varying directly with the propeller speed causing the fluid or air to be accelerated thru the channel or trough to the trailing edge of the propeller. This additional flow increases the propeller capacity additional jetting action bootstrapping causing the propeller to turn more easily, all of which increases the propeller thrust and efficiency as much as 10 percent. |
